Что такое одиночный топ в Android?
В этом режиме запуска, если экземпляр активности уже существует поверх текущей задачи, новый экземпляр не будет создан, и система Android направит информацию о намерениях через onNewIntent(). Если экземпляр отсутствует в верхней части задачи, будет создан новый экземпляр.
Что такое единый экземпляр Android?
Активность «единого экземпляра» стоит отдельно как единственное действие в вашей задаче. Если вы запустите другое действие, это действие запустится в другой задаче, независимо от ее режима запуска, как если бы FLAG_ACTIVITY_NEW_TASK был в намерении. Во всем остальном режим «singleInstance» идентичен «singleTask».
Что такое задний стек в Android?
Задача — это набор действий, с которыми взаимодействуют пользователи при выполнении определенной работы. Действия организованы в стек (задний стек) — в порядок, в котором открывается каждое действие. … Если пользователь нажимает кнопку «Назад», это новое действие завершается и исчезает из стека.
Что такое режимы загрузки Android?
В Android существует четыре типа режимов загрузки: Стандарт. Синглтоп. одиночная задача.
Как использовать onNewIntent в Android?
Как использовать onNewIntent метод в андроид. применение Активность
- Слабая ссылка mActivity;mActivity.get()
- ActivityStackStack; ActivityStack.lastElement()
- (Активность) param.thisObject.
Что такое настоящий экспортированный Android?
Android: экспортировано Может ли широковещательный приемник получать сообщения от источников за пределами вашего приложения. — «верно», если можно, и «ложно», если нет. Если установлено значение «false», получатель широковещательной рассылки может получать только те сообщения, которые отправляются компонентами того же приложения или приложений с тем же идентификатором пользователя.
Какие типы сервисов есть в Android?
Типы сервисов Android
- Услуги на переднем плане: …
- Фоновые услуги: …
- Связанные услуги: …
- Воспроизведение музыки в фоновом режиме — очень распространенный пример сервисов на Android. …
- Шаг 1: Создайте новый проект.
- Шаг 2: Измените файл strings.xml. …
- Шаг 3. Работа с файлом activity_main.xml. …
- Шаг 4: Создание пользовательского класса обслуживания.
Как узнать, пуст ли мой Backstack?
вы можете использовать стек осколков, помещая в него осколки. Носить getBackStackEntryCount(), чтобы получить считать. Если это ноль, это ничего не значит в backstack.
Что такое индикатор намерений в Android?
Используйте флаги намерений
намерения используется для запуска действий в Android. Вы можете установить флаги, которые контролируют задачу, которая будет содержать действие. Флаги существуют для создания нового действия, использования существующего действия или вывода существующего экземпляра действия на передний план. … setFlags(Intent. FLAG_ACTIVITY_CLEAR_TASK | Intent.
Что такое активность переднего плана в Android?
Приложение считается активным, если выполняется любое из следующих условий: имеет видимую активность, независимо от того, запущено действие или приостановлено. Он имеет крупный план обслуживания. Другое приложение переднего плана подключается к приложению либо путем ссылки на одну из его служб, либо с помощью одного из его поставщиков содержимого.
Как найти местоположение на Android?
Помогите своему телефону определить более точное местоположение (службы определения местоположения Google, также известные как Google Location Accuracy)
- Проведите вниз от верхней части экрана.
- Коснитесь и удерживайте местоположение . Если вы не можете найти местоположение, нажмите «Изменить» или «Настройки». …
- Нажмите Дополнительно. Точность местоположения Google.
- Включите или выключите параметр Улучшить точность определения местоположения.
Что такое фильтр намерений в Android?
Фильтр намерений выражение в файле манифеста приложения, указывающее тип намерений, которые компонент хотел бы получить. Например, объявляя фильтр намерений для действия, вы разрешаете другим приложениям напрямую запускать ваше действие с определенным типом намерения.
Какова основная деятельность в Android?
Как правило, действие реализует экран в приложении. …Обычно активность в приложении указывается как основная активность, т.е. первый экран, который появляется, когда пользователь запускает приложение. Затем каждое действие может запустить другое действие для выполнения различных действий.
Что такое метод onCreate в Android?
onCreate это используется для начала деятельности. super используется для вызова конструктора основного класса. setContentView используется для установки xml.
Для чего используется Onnewintent на Android?
3 ответа. это называется действия, которые устанавливают для параметра launchMode значение «singleTop» в вашего пакета или если клиент использовал флаг FLAG_ACTIVITY_SINGLE_TOP при вызове startActivity(Intent). Если вы установите только наверх, действие не запустится, если оно уже выполняется на вершине стека истории.
Что делает finish() в Android?
Когда вы вызываете finish() для действия, выполняется метод onDestroy(). Этот метод может делать такие вещи, как: Закройте все диалоги, которыми управляла активность. Закрывает курсоры, которыми управляла активность.